Output c50121c65c9d669f14d244d8058196a03a2c2a961a06a365363b4acc007de39a:0

value
20075343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ad1414e585a303c3eb8c68f6b668ea6950bddcb OP_EQUAL
address
3CtR3FFDbsMW95vgbf4az7PqVFsWcjERtb
transaction
c50121c65c9d669f14d244d8058196a03a2c2a961a06a365363b4acc007de39a
spent
true